Role Summary
The Portfolio Specialist is a member of the investment organization. The primary role of the Portfolio Specialist is to support portfolio managers and investment teams by representing them in meetings and communications with institutional and intermediary prospects, clients, consultants, and internal staff.
A primary objective of the role is to minimize the amount of time spent by portfolio managers and their investment teams meeting and communicating with prospects, clients, and consultants; enabling portfolio management teams to place maximum focus on the investment process, while at the same time helping to ensure that the firm excels in its sales and client service efforts.
The Portfolio Specialist works closely with sales, consultant relations, client service and other internal staff to communicate relevant information regarding the investment strategies supported; including reviewing investment performance, portfolio composition and characteristics, rationale for holdings, investment decisions, etc. The Portfolio Specialist is accompanied by sales and client service professionals in meetings and presentations and participates with registered personnel in meetings and presentations regarding all vehicles related to the strategies.
